linking computers
Well here i go, me and my buddy would like to play C2 against each other...
we have 2 computers and 2 games installled on both...
what kind of link or something would i have to get to play against each other?

Re: linking computers
Wrong forum. Should go in the technical assistance forum.
Moved.
And to help you out - a standard PC to PC lan connection would work. All you need are two lan cards and a crossover lan cable.

Re: linking computers
Its very simple. find the IP address of the other guy, and make sure he knows yours just in case. now, you can choose to host the game, or to join his game and let him host, to join his you must join his IP essentially, and thats what you type in, and normally it will join you, and vice versa. TCP/IP are probly the best and easiest connections, but that is dependant on if you actaully have internet
